Hyundai Creta EX(O) Now Gets Panoramic Sunroof at Rs 12.97 lacs.

The newly added EX(O) variant is the most affordable Hyundai Creta trim to offer a panoramic sunroof.

In Creta line-up, the EX(O) trim offers a panoramic sunroof and LED reading lamps as standard. The variant starts at Rs 12.97 lakh and can be had with both the 1.5-litre turbo-diesel and 1.5-litre naturally aspirated petrol engine options, mated to either a 6-speed manual or a CVT transmission.

The Creta’s new SX Premium variant comes equipped with a Bose 8-speaker sound system, ventilated front seats, an 8-way power-adjustable driver’s seat, leather upholstery for all seats, and scooped-out seatbacks for extra second-row legroom.

Most of the Creta’s SX(O) variants have undergone a price increase of Rs 8,000 as part of the 2025 model refresh, and it now starts at Rs 17.46 lakh. Curiously, Hyundai hasn’t hiked prices for the SX(O) diesel automatic trim, which still costs Rs 19.99 lakh.

Hyundai will now offer a smart key with motion sensor starting from the S(O) variants, and the SX(O) trims will come with a rain sensor, rear wireless charger and scooped seatbacks. Buyers can also choose two new colour options Titan Grey Matte and Starry Night on all Creta variants.
